Answer to Question 2

Answers will vary and should include an identified individual and characteristics that
demonstrate wisdom in the student's eyes. A comparison of characteristics of
wisdom outlined in the textbook should follow, including a broad, practical approach
to life, great insight into the complexities and uncertainties of human nature, and
looking to enduring truths rather than contemporary quick fixes for answers.

For high blood pressure (hypertension), a new class of drug, called a vasopeptidase blocker (inhibitor), has been developed. It decreases blood pressure by simultaneously dilating the peripheral arteries and increasing the body's loss of salt.

Nearly all drugs pass into human breast milk. How often a drug is taken influences the amount of drug that will pass into the milk. Medications taken 30 to 60 minutes before breastfeeding are likely to be at peak blood levels when the baby is nursing.

Inotropic therapy does not have a role in the treatment of most heart failure patients. These drugs can make patients feel and function better but usually do not lengthen the predicted length of their lives.
